    Paul, not a bad try and a cute gal. At least your got yours to pose for you. Two things....1. get something to hold over her to block the sun from hitting her. A professional reflector or just a sheet of foam core or insulation from 84 Lumber. Just something to block the sun. That will make a vast improvement. 2....Whenever you lean a subject on their hands get them to barley touch the hands. When they lean too hard it bunches up the face as in your photo.
